hi guys any idea how much heat wrap is required to wrap a set of headers and up pipe? ie 1"x50' thanks

2"x50 feet roll of DEI heat wrap will generally do a set of tubular headers and up-pipe. A further roll of the same is required for a 3" down pipe with a little left over.
